Transaction 263b32ccdb86abf37c75e6a6fdb37a4dabfdbeab5fc9d45fadee51f93a080305

1 Input
2 Outputs
  • 263b32ccdb86abf37c75e6a6fdb37a4dabfdbeab5fc9d45fadee51f93a080305:0
  • value  16371643
    address  3NT4yLe69Vr3egEUHTvVVkkTBP5CY8hAYh
  • 263b32ccdb86abf37c75e6a6fdb37a4dabfdbeab5fc9d45fadee51f93a080305:1
  • value  214662
    address  1DrHXqEx683nfRPGQGz91uVPRAXMsZ9zAL